File: mrw.inp

package info (click to toggle)
gretl 2022c-1
  • links: PTS, VCS
  • area: main
  • in suites: bookworm
  • size: 59,552 kB
  • sloc: ansic: 409,074; sh: 4,449; makefile: 3,222; cpp: 2,777; xml: 599; perl: 364
file content (40 lines) | stat: -rw-r--r-- 1,082 bytes parent folder | download | duplicates (4)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
# Replicate Table 1, "Estimation of the Textbook
# Solow model," in Mankiw, Romer and Weil, QJE 1992
open mrw.gdt
series lny = log(gdp85)
series ngd = 0.05 + (popgrow/100.0)
series lngd = log(ngd)
series linv = log(inv/100.0)
# generate variable for testing Solow restriction
series x3 = linv - lngd
# set sample to non-oil producing countries
smpl nonoil --dummy
model1 <- ols lny const linv lngd
scalar essu = $ess
scalar dfu1 = $df
# restricted regression
ols lny const x3
scalar F1 = ($ess - essu)/(essu/dfu1)
# set sample to the "better data" countries
smpl intermed --dummy --replace
model2 <- ols lny const linv lngd
scalar essu = $ess
scalar dfu2 = $df
# restricted regression
ols lny const x3
scalar F2 = ($ess - essu)/(essu/dfu2)
# set sample to the OECD countries
smpl OECD --dummy --replace
model3 <- ols lny const linv lngd
scalar essu = $ess
scalar dfu3 = $df
# restricted regression
ols lny const x3
scalar F3 = ($ess - essu)/(essu/dfu3)
print F1 F2 F3
# pvalues for test of Solow restriction in each sample
pvalue F 1 dfu1 F1
pvalue F 1 dfu2 F2
pvalue F 1 dfu3 F3